Is monster energy drink bad for you - Four Monster energy drinks in one day can be harmful and pose serious health risks. It is likely to cause a blood sugar spike, heart palpitations, dehydration, insomnia, headaches, irritability, and other caffeine overdose symptoms. Typically, an individual should not exceed the advised caffeine intake of 400 mg.

Monster cans, like the vast majority of ready-to-drink energy drinks, have an expiration date that ranges from 18 to 24 months after production. If properly stored, your beverages should last 6 to 9 months after their expiration date. A 16 fl. oz can of Monster Energy contains 54 g of sugar – roughly 13.5 tablespoons of sugar in a single can. Getting much of this sugar from Monster can definitely put your health at risk.
